Ronnie Radke Confirms Breakup

The frontman of Falling In Reverse, Ronnie Radke, has officially confirmed the end of his relationship with professional fighter Saraya after six years together.

The singer shared a video on social media, initially recorded by a fan, revealing that he and Saraya had been separated for about three months but were still on good terms.

In the video, he stated: “We were broken up for damn three months. Where the hell are you guys? Saraya lives three minutes from me. We talk all the time, we chat every day; she is my friend. Sometimes things don’t go the way you all want.”

Details of Their Relationship

Radke described his ex-girlfriend as a good person, explaining that they simply “broke up” and suggesting that their fans are more upset about the split than they are. He added: “She is rich, damn it, I am rich, like a dude, we are living our lives. Relax, guys, stop getting into my DMs… We have been through ups and downs a few months ago. I understand you’re in shock. But listen – let go, everything will be fine, okay? Leave us alone!”

Radke began dating Saraya in late 2018. Born Saraya-Jade Bevis, she previously went by the name Paige in WWE. She left WWE to join AEW in 2022.

Coming from a wrestling family, Saraya appeared in the 2012 documentary “Fighters: Fighting My Family,” which was later adapted into the 2019 film “Fighting with My Family,” where she was portrayed by Florence Pugh.

During her relationship with Radke, Saraya appeared in two music videos for Falling In Reverse and provided backing vocals on his track “Bad Guy” from the 2024 album “Popular Monster.”

Meanwhile, Radke faced delays last month regarding a tour with Falling In Reverse due to visa restrictions for individuals with prison sentences of 12 months or more. In the 2000s, he served more than a year in prison related to a deadly altercation that resulted in the death of an 18-year-old. Billboard reported on the situation.
